China Proposes Summit Between Putin and Trump to Resolve Ukraine Conflict

China has proposed a summit between Putin and Trump to help resolve the Ukraine conflict. Trump’s recent calls reveal interest from both Putin and Zelenskiy in peace talks. While the Kremlin acknowledges a potential meeting, no direct peace discussions have been held since the war began. Ukraine insists on territorial withdrawal and security guarantees, while China seeks to promote negotiations as a neutral party.

China has proposed a summit between Russian President Vladimir Putin and former US President Donald Trump aimed at resolving the ongoing war in Ukraine. Reports indicate that Chinese officials have approached the Trump team through intermediaries to facilitate peacekeeping efforts following a potential truce. China’s foreign ministry has not provided any comments regarding this proposal.

In recent communications, Trump mentioned that both Putin and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skiy showed interest in peace during separate phone calls he had with them. Trump has instructed key US officials to initiate discussions on bringing an end to the conflict in Ukraine. The Kremlin has acknowledged an agreement between Putin and Trump to meet, with Putin inviting Trump to Moscow, suggesting their first meeting might occur in Saudi Arabia.

Despite efforts, no peace talks regarding Ukraine have taken place since the early days of the conflict, which is nearing its third anniversary. Trump’s predecessor, President Joe Biden, had supplied substantial military aid to Ukraine but did not engage in direct discussions with Putin post-invasion. Currently, Russia controls roughly one-fifth of Ukrainian territory, demanding territorial concessions and a neutral stance from Kyiv as part of any peace agreement.

Ukraine has made it clear that it requires the withdrawal of Russian forces from occupied lands and is seeking NATO membership or equivalent security guarantees to ensure protection against future aggressions. The West has repeatedly urged China to leverage its relationship with Russia to facilitate peace talks. However, China maintains its position as a neutral party in the conflict, advocating for peace-oriented discussions on its terms.

Last year, China, in collaboration with Brazil, proposed an international peace conference at an appropriate time, advocating for equal participation from both Ukraine and Russia in the discussions, emphasizing a balanced approach to peace-making efforts.
